
Paperback
Published 17 Apr 2015
- $47.60
45 results
Paperback
Published 17 Apr 2015
Paperback
Published 05 Feb 2019
Paperback
Published 11 Nov 2015
Paperback
Published 01 Feb 2015
Hardback
Published 17 Oct 1997
Paperback
Paperback
Paperback
Published 25 Jan 2019
Paperback
Published 01 Jan 1982
Paperback
Paperback
Paperback
Published 01 Jan 1986
Paperback
Published 01 Jan 1988
Paperback
Paperback
Paperback
Paperback
Paperback
Published 01 Jul 1990
Hardback
Paperback
Paperback
Published 14 Mar 1995
Paperback
Published 18 Feb 2013
Paperback
Published 23 May 2001
Paperback
Published 14 Mar 2006
Paperback
Paperback
Paperback
Published 01 Jan 2006
Book
Published 01 Jan 1980
Book
Published 01 Jan 1980
Book
Published 01 Jan 1978
Book
Published 01 Jan 1990
Book
Published 01 Jan 1995
Book
Published 01 Jan 1976
Book
Published 01 Mar 1975
Book
Published 15 Nov 1989
Book
Published 01 Jan 1985
Hardback
Published 30 Jun 2009
Paperback
Published 12 Aug 2003
Paperback
Paperback
Paperback